Giving Joao Moreira the Pakistan Star ride to ‘change luck’ could be just a one-off, says Tony Cruz
Trainer says taking Matthew Chadwick off the boom youngster is a nod to public opinion
The booking of Joao Moreira to “change the luck” for Pakistan Star in next Tuesday’s Griffin Trophy at Sha Tin could be a one-off engagement, according to the boom youngster’s trainer, Tony Cruz.
Regular rider Matthew Chadwick had his critics over his performances on Pakistan Star in the three-year-old’s past three defeats but former world-class jockey Cruz wasn’t one of them. Cruz had preferred to point out the disadvantage the handicapper had imposed on the inexperienced and green Pakistan Star by lifting him up the ratings too quickly to be meeting older, experienced and good-quality gallopers before he was ready.
But there is no commitment on either side for Moreira to stay on Pakistan Star beyond Tuesday’s three-year-old feature.
